A lower bound on the tree-width of graphs with irrelevant vertices

Discrete Mathematics 2019-01-15 v1 Combinatorics

Abstract

For their famous algorithm for the disjoint paths problem, Robertson and Seymour proved that there is a function ff such that if the tree-width of a graph GG with kk pairs of terminals is at least f(k)f(k), then GG contains a solution-irrelevant vertex (Graph Minors. XXII., JCTB 2012). We give a single-exponential lower bound on ff. This bound even holds for planar graphs.
